The Recruitment Team in the Office of the Registrar is currently seeking a Recurring Part-time Student Recruitment Assistant.
The Student Recruitment Team in Student and Enrolment Services supports the attraction of top undergraduate students from around the world through strategic marketing and recruitment initiatives, including the delivery of a series of events for prospective students, applicants, parents, counsellors, and other stakeholders. The Student Recruitment Team handles tens of thousands of inquiries pertaining to high school and transfer applications. Reporting to the Assistant Registrar, Student Recruitment and Applicant Relations this recurring part-time position serves to support the Student Recruitment Team in Student in the Office of the Registrar.
The business day for Enrolment services runs from 8:30 am thru 4:30 pm Monday-Friday. Shifts will typically range from 4-5 hours in duration up to a full 7 hour, Monday to Friday with the exception of statutory holidays and closures. Peak periods are August-September and January.

Summary of Key Responsibilities (job functions include but are not limited to):

  • Provides informational services (in groups, in person, on the phone, social media, via email) to prospective international students, families, and guidance counsellors.
  • Presentations to varied audiences.
  • Communicates information pertaining to the University of Calgary in an accurate, timely, and honest manner.
  • Detailed Knowledge of the University of Calgary’s programs, services, enrolment policies and procedures is ensured.
  • Provides pre-admission advising and support of the admissions process to prospective international students and their families.
  • Updating and maintaining international student, parent, counsellor, and institutional records in the Recruitment CRM.
  • Assisting in the development of several mass e-mail and phone call campaigns to further Recruitment and Admission Objectives.
  • Uploading prospective student leads into the CRM.
  • Assisting with registration issues for prospective student events and campus tours.
  • Assisting the Student Recruitment Team during peak times with ensuring recruitment trips and events, counsellor databases, and inventory are inputted into the CRM.
  • Assisting the Student Recruitment Team during peak times with the distribution of recruitment materials.
  • Supporting the mailout of physical materials to prospective international applicants.
  • Assisting the Student Recruitment Assistant with the administration of the Campus Tours both in-person and virtually.
  • Acts as a resource within other units of the Office of the Registrar.

QUALIFICATIONS / REQUIREMENTS:

  • Post-secondary education in a related field. An undergraduate degree is preferred.
  • Demonstrated knowledge of the organizational structure of the University of Calgary with regard to such factors as location, student population and academic programs is considered an asset.
  • Ability to manage change and demonstrate success in leading change initiatives.
  • Strong written and oral communication skills.
  • Demonstrated ability to work and communicate with diverse groups of people.
  • Demonstrated ability to establish and maintain cooperative working relationships with staff, colleagues, school administrators, officials and representatives.
  • Demonstrated ability to work in a fast-paced, high pressure, team-based environment and meet deadlines.
  • Knowledge of PeopleSoft or EzRecruit CRM would be an asset.
  • Ability to work independently with minimal supervision.
  • Willing to work evenings and weekends as required.
